Owners of SAAB 9-3 models manufactured between 2003 and 2011 will be aware that the ignition keys of their vehicles tend to wear out. It can be a hassle to lose a key, or even to have it stolen.
Replacing only one key is costly. It requires an entirely new computer module that is compatible with the car (saab car keys CIM, saab replacement keys uk TWICE), plus programming.

Misplacing Keys
It's very easy for a car owner to misplace their keys. If you place your keys in a pocket and then take a shower to prepare for work or dinner you are more likely to "drift away" from their original location. It is crucial to keep a spare set of keys with you at all times.
If you're missing a key-fob, the best place to start searching is the place you usually keep it. It is also recommended to check pockets in the outfit you were wearing that day. The same goes for any other items you might have carried around like handbags and purses.
For older SAAB models from 2003 and earlier, you can add an extra key fob to your vehicle, however you will need to have at least one of the keys available so that the new fob is able to be linked with your car. This can be done by the dealer using a specialized Tech2 device.
A service technician from a dealer is likely to charge $200 to program a new key fob in order to replace a lost one. A mobile SAAB locksmith will be able re-program your computer EEPROM, and then prepare your vehicle to accept the new key. This service is only a fraction of the cost. Broken Keys
Saab owners should always have a spare key in case it gets lost or stolen. The car can't start without the key fob. It relies on the microchip that reads and recognizes your key. We recommend using a mobile lock technician for a quick and reliable service.
All key fobs used to lock and unlock your car contain batteries. They can also go out over time. Replace the battery on your car key fob regularly to ensure it doesn't fail when you're most in need of it.
It is simple to replace the battery on a key fob, without the need for special tools. First, you will need to remove the emergency key from the case of the old fob by inserting a flathead screwdriver in the slot located in the middle of the case. You will then be able to gently pushing the key fob to open. You can then remove the electronic components and replace them with a brand new battery.
